1973 Road Runner Lemon Law in Washington

Washington's lemon law primarily covers new vehicle purchases. If you purchased your 1973 Plymouth Road Runner new and experienced persistent defects early on, you may have had lemon law protections. For used 1973 Road Runner purchases, check Washington's used car consumer protection laws and implied warranty rules. Washington's Lemon Law covers new vehicles within 24 months or 24,000 miles. After four repair attempts, two for a condition likely to cause death or serious injury, or 30 days out of service, the consumer can seek a refund or replacement.

Registering a 1973 Road Runner in Washington

All Plymouth Road Runner vehicles driven in Washington must be registered with the state DMV. Washington charges a $30 base registration fee. In areas with regional transit authority (Sound Transit), an additional RTA excise tax of 1.1% of vehicle value applies. EV owners pay a $225 annual fee.
